Palm Springs, FL Job Details $18 - $23 an hour 3 hours ago Qualifications Appeals Health insurance policy knowledge Medical insurance appeals management Medical claims submission Insurance claims appeal handling Full Job Description Position Summary The Medical Billing & Coding Specialist is responsible for accurate medical coding, timely claim submission, and effective follow-up to ensure optimal reimbursement. This role plays a critical part in the revenue cycle by preparing, reviewing, and submitting clean claims, resolving unpaid or denied claims, and maintaining compliance with coding and payer requirements.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, self-motivated, and experienced in working with a variety of insurance plans. Key Responsibilities Prepare, review, and submit clean claims to insurance carriers electronically in a timely manner. Review and correct denied or unpaid claims and resubmit as appropriate. Identify, investigate, and resolve billing discrepancies and payer issues. Apply accurate CPT codes, ICD-10 diagnoses, and appropriate modifiers in accordance with payer guidelines. Perform account follow-up and manage appeals to ensure proper reimbursement. Prepare, review, and send patient statements. Adhere to established timelines for billing, filing, and payment cycles. Maintain accurate and complete documentation in billing systems and EMRs. Communicate effectively with insurance companies, internal teams, and patients as needed. Work collaboratively with clinical and administrative teams to resolve coding and billing issues. Support credentialing activities as needed (preferred, not required). Qualifications Required Minimum of 2 years of medical billing and coding experience. Strong knowledge of CPT coding, ICD-10 coding, and appropriate modifiers. Experience with claim submission, account follow-up, and appeals. Working knowledge of insurance plans. High attention to detail with the ability to produce accurate, high-quality work. Strong time management and organ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work effectively as part of a team. Self-starter with a focused, goal-driven mindset and proven results.
